We’re looking for a Senior Customer Success Manager to support high-value customers in the assigned vertical by providing the tools and resources to achieve their business goals on social media. In this role, you’ll build, cultivate, and maintain influential relationships with your customers by leveraging your customer success experience and demonstrating expert-level competency in Hootsuite’s product, industry trends and best practices. You will drive business outcomes for your customers while being accountable for best-in-class user adoption, revenue retention and growth, and customer advocacy, guiding customers through their journey of social maturity. You will consistently and proactively review, refine and re-validate plans to ensure the customer gains full value from the product suite, the partnership, Hootsuite and social media as a channel. Based within a commuting-distance of our Toronto office, you will report to the Senior Manager, Customer Success.


WHAT YOU’LL DO:

  • Lead day to day relationship management for a book of business of high-value customers (Fortune 1000 sized businesses); guide customers to success on their social journey with Hootsuite’s Enterprise and partner products.
  • Build and maintain influential relationships with customers with highly complex use cases in the assigned vertical(s), from end users through to executive sponsors, ensuring they have a consistent, best-in-class experience in every interaction.
  • Cultivate and demonstrate a high level of expertise in Hootsuite's products, social media and your assigned vertical(s) by keeping up with industry trends and best practices.
  • Engage with customers in your assigned vertical(s) in a high-touch, multi-threaded approach, including ensuring successful onboarding, defining Mutual Account Plans with customers, leading success reviews, value workshops, and regular check-ins to drive engagement and ensure Hoosuite is delivering against customer's goals and outcomes according to the success plan.
  • Actively monitor account health and adoption throughout the full duration of the customer relationship; provide guidance on how customers can advance their social strategies; intervene with adoption strategies that showcase how customers can
    enhance their workflows and better use our products; leverage value / industry specific workshops, trends, and social expertise to increase customer’s social maturity.
  • Collaborate with Account Manager to develop account strategies and identify qualified leads (CSQL) for account expansion.
  • Advocate for product features and improvements as the voice of the customer and works cross-functionally with internal product teams to champion adoption and change.
  • Collaborate with Customer Success teammates to meet and exceed quarterly regional targets, while being accountable for individual quarterly metrics including Personal Net Renewal Rate, CSQL, Customer Health, Adoption, and Advocacy.
  • Actively participate in internal training, knowledge sharing and collaboration sessions
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.

What you need to know about the Montreal Tech Scene

With roots dating back to 1642, Montreal is often recognized for its French-inspired architecture and cobblestone streets lined with traditional shops and cafés. But what truly sets the city apart is how it blends its rich tradition with a modern edge, reflected in its evolving skyline and fast-growing tech industry. According to economic promotion agency Montréal International, the city ranks among the top in North America to invest in artificial intelligence, making it le spot idéal for job seekers who want the best of both worlds.

Key Facts About Montreal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 255,000+ (2024, Tourisme Montréal)
  • Major Tech Employers: SAP, Google, Microsoft, Cisco
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, machine learning, cybersecurity, cloud computing, web development
  • Funding Landscape: $1.47 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(BetaKit)
  • Notable Investors: CIBC Innovation Banking, BDC Capital, Investissement Québec, Fonds de solidarité FTQ
  • Research Centers and Universities: McGill University, Université de Montréal, Concordia University, Mila Quebec, ÉTS Montréal
